Raw Materials

The primary raw materials for gelatine production include animal by-products such as pig skins, bovine hides, and bones. The availability and cost of these raw materials, influenced by livestock industry dynamics, directly impact production expenses.

The primary raw materials for gelatin production—pig skins, bovine hides, and bones—are critical factors that determine both the cost and quality of the final product. These animal-derived sources are rich in collagen, which is essential for gelatin’s gelling properties. The availability and cost of these raw materials are influenced by several factors within the livestock industry, including supply chain dynamics, seasonal variations, and regional production practices.

Pig Skins: The Dominant Source of Gelatin

Pig skins are the most common raw material used in gelatin production, accounting for around 40% of the global edible gelatin output. Their popularity stems from a high collagen content and efficient extraction methods. Regions with significant pork production, such as North America and Europe, typically have a steady and cost-effective supply of pig skins.

The cost of pig skins fluctuates based on trends in the pork industry, including slaughter rates and consumer demand for pork products. When pork consumption is high, the availability of pig skins may decrease, pushing prices up. Conversely, during periods of low demand for pork, pig skins become more abundant and less expensive.

Bovine Hides: Versatile Raw Material

Bovine hides contribute to approximately 30% of gelatin production worldwide. They provide versatility in producing different types of gelatin (Type A and Type B), which cater to diverse applications in food, pharmaceuticals, and cosmetics.

The availability and price of bovine hides are closely linked to the beef industry. Changes in cattle slaughter rates, beef consumption trends, and regional farming methods impact supply and costs. High beef demand regions may face higher prices for bovine hides, while areas with lower beef consumption may have better availability and lower costs.

Bones: Important Source for High-Quality Gelatin

Bones, especially from cattle, are another vital raw material due to their rich collagen content. These are often by-products sourced from slaughterhouses and meat processing facilities. The supply of bones depends on the scale and efficiency of meat processing operations. The cost can vary based on livestock industry health and regional processing capabilities.

Manufacturing Process

Gelatine production involves several key steps:

  • Pre-treatment of raw materials through cleaning and acid/alkaline treatment

  • Extraction of collagen using hot water or acid

  • Filtration and concentration

  • Drying and milling into powder form

Process optimization to maximize yield while maintaining quality is crucial for controlling costs.

Pre-feasibility Considerations

Evaluations focus on raw material supply consistency, market demand from food and pharmaceutical sectors, regulatory compliance (especially hygiene and safety), and capital versus operational costs.

Evaluations for establishing or expanding gelatin production facilities involve a detailed analysis of several critical aspects to ensure operational efficiency, market alignment, and regulatory compliance.

Raw Material Supply Consistency

A reliable and steady supply of raw materials—primarily pig skins, bovine hides, and bones—is fundamental to gelatin production. The availability of these animal by-products depends heavily on livestock industry conditions such as slaughter rates, meat demand, and farming practices. Fluctuations in livestock populations, disease outbreaks, or shifts in meat consumption can disrupt raw material supply chains, leading to production delays and increased costs. Regions with robust pork or beef industries generally offer more consistent raw material supplies, which is a significant factor when selecting a plant location.

Market Demand from Food and Pharmaceutical Sectors

Gelatin’s demand is driven largely by the food and pharmaceutical industries. In food manufacturing, gelatin is widely used as a gelling agent, stabilizer, and thickener in products like candies, desserts, and dairy. The pharmaceutical sector utilizes gelatin extensively for capsules, tablets, and other formulations. Understanding current and projected market demand in these sectors is crucial to sizing production capacity and planning product lines. Market trends such as increasing consumer preference for clean-label ingredients and the rise of nutraceuticals also influence demand forecasts.

Regulatory Compliance (Especially Hygiene and Safety)

Gelatin production must comply with stringent regulatory requirements to ensure product safety and quality. This includes adherence to Good Manufacturing Practices (GMP), Hazard Analysis and Critical Control Points (HACCP), and food safety standards enforced by authorities such as the FDA, EFSA, or equivalent bodies. Hygiene protocols during raw material handling and processing are critical to prevent contamination. Additionally, sourcing regulations concerning animal welfare and traceability must be strictly followed. Achieving relevant certifications (e.g., ISO 9001, Halal, Kosher) can also be important for market access.

Gelatine Production CostCapital versus Operational Costs

A comprehensive financial evaluation compares capital expenditures (CapEx) and operational expenditures (OpEx). Capital costs include land acquisition, facility construction, machinery, and installation. These upfront investments can be substantial given the specialized equipment required for extraction, purification, and drying processes. Operational costs involve raw materials, labor, utilities (water, steam, electricity), maintenance, and logistics. Optimizing operational efficiency to control these ongoing expenses is essential for profitability. Financial modeling, including break-even analysis and return on investment (ROI), helps in assessing project feasibility and guiding investment decisions.
